Prison Violence
How do we get my inmate into a safer cell block away from gangs?
He needs to get with his counselor or case manager and request a cell change.…

He needs to get with his counselor or case manager and request a cell change. This carries some potential danger as the "gang members" will see that as a diss. The other option is to ask to be in Ad Sec (Administrative Segregation) which is essentially solitary confinement but no one would be able to get to him there.

Law & Court Questions - Legal Terms
What is a motion of discovery
A motion for discovery is a motion made to the court by the party of a criminal proceeding or civil lawsuit to obtain information or evidence regarding the…

A motion for discovery is a motion made to the court by the party of a criminal proceeding or civil lawsuit to obtain information or evidence regarding the case. As an example, a motion of discovery provides the defendant with notes made by an FBI agent during or shortly after interviewing a potential witness.

Release Questions
How Do You Get Your Money Back When Released From Prison?
Both are returned to you upon full release, but how that money comes back to you matters more than most people expect going out the door.…

Both are returned to you upon full release, but how that money comes back to you matters more than most people expect going out the door. The facility typically returns remaining funds on a debit card issued at release rather than cash. That sounds convenient until you read the fine print. Most of these release debit cards carry fees that chip away at the balance every time the card is used, sometimes per transaction, sometimes as a monthly maintenance fee, sometimes...

Send Inmate Money
Can I Put Money on Books Right After Paying Off Restitution?
Yes, immediately.…

Yes, immediately. Once the restitution is paid in full there is no waiting period before you can deposit funds into the inmate's trust account. The two things are handled through entirely separate systems and one does not create a hold on the other. Restitution payments go to the court or the victim compensation fund depending on how the order is structured. Commissary deposits go directly into the inmate's trust account through whatever platform the facility uses, whether that is JPay, TouchPay,...

Inmate Transfer
Will an Inmate Transfer to Face an Outstanding Warrant?
Yes, and the process is more structured than most people realize.…

Yes, and the process is more structured than most people realize. When an inmate has an outstanding warrant from another jurisdiction, that jurisdiction places what is called a detainer on them. A detainer is a formal legal hold that notifies the facility currently housing the inmate that another agency has a claim on them. It essentially says do not release this person without notifying us first. Once the current sentence or custody situation is resolved, or sometimes while it is still ongoing...

After Prison Challenges & Services
When will the new laws come in effect?
The only "new law" that has been in the news related to inmates getting early release is the First Step Act.…

The only "new law" that has been in the news related to inmates getting early release is the First Step Act. The first major date was July 19, 2019, when 3,100 federal inmates were granted early release. In fact, this law is limited to only ten percent of the entire prison population in the country.
